How many locations does i9 sports have?
Since 2003, i9 Sports®, the nation’s first and largest youth sports league franchise business in the United States, has served 2.5 million participants at over 925 locations across 30 states nationwide.

What sports does i9 offer?
We offer recreational sports leagues, camps and clinics for boys and girls in today’s most popular sports such as flag football, soccer, basketball, baseball, ZIP Lacrosse™ and volleyball. Our coaches and instructors provide age-appropriate instruction that’s both fun for kids and convenient for busy families.
What sports franchise is worth the most?
The Dallas Cowboys
The Dallas Cowboys once again claim the top spot with a valuation of $5.7 billion, followed by the New York Yankees at $5.25 billion. The NBA’s New York Knicks round out the top three at $5 billion.

Who fills out an i9?
All U.S. employers must properly complete Form I-9 for each individual they hire for employment in the United States. This includes citizens and noncitizens. Both employees and employers (or authorized representatives of the employer) must complete the form.
